    Job Title: Unblinded Clinical Research Coordinator Pay Range: Up to $27 per hour Schedule: Monday - Friday, 8:00 AM - 5:00 PM Duration: 90-day contract with potential for extension or conversion to a permanent position based on performance and trial needs. Position Summary: This full-time role supports the day-to-day operations of clinical trials, with a strong focus on Investigational Product (IP) management while maintaining study integrity between blinded and unblinded staff. The Unblinded CRC serves as the subject-matter expert for IP handling and works closely with the Site Manager, study team, sponsors, and participants to ensure compliance with protocols and SOPs. Key Responsibilities: Managing all aspects of Investigational Product (receipt, storage, dispensing, administration, accountability, and return/destruction) Maintaining the study blind and communicating appropriately with blinded and unblinded team members Conducting patient-facing visits, including vitals, ECGs, lab collection, and protocol-required procedures Completing accurate source documentation and EDC entry within required timelines Monitoring study activities for regulatory and protocol compliance Recording and reporting adverse events and resolving sponsor queries Participating in site audits, monitor visits, investigator meetings, and site initiation visits Maintaining temperature logs, pharmacy binders, and master study logs This position reports directly to the Site Manager/Director and plays a critical role in ensuring studies run smoothly and compliantly. Required Qualifications: Recent, heavy hands-on injection or vaccine administration experience, including independent injection administration in accordance with medication protocols Patient-facing clinical experience (Medical Assistant, Clinical Research Assistant, Research Assistant, LPN, etc.) Ability to work directly with study participants in a clinical setting Strong attention to detail and accurate documentation skills Ability to complete source documentation during patient visits and enter data into EDC within required timelines Ability to follow study protocols, SOPs, and regulatory requirements Basic understanding of GCP and FDA regulations (training acceptable) Strong communication and organizational skills Ability to work Monday-Friday, 8:00 AM-5:00 PM Ability to start ASAP Preferred Qualifications: Previous experience as a Clinical Research Coordinator (CRC) Unblinded CRC or Investigational Product (IP) management experience Experience with drug accountability, temperature logs, and pharmacy binders Experience with Investigational Product preparation and administration Experience participating in monitor visits, audits, SIVs, and investigator meetings Experience using EDC systems and resolving sponsor queries Work Environment: On-site clinical research site supporting active clinical trials and patient-facing activities.

    Screens potential patients for protocol eligibility. Presents trial concepts and details to the patients, participates in the informed consent process, and enrolls patients on protocol. Coordinates patient care in compliance with protocol requirements. May disburse investigational drug and provide patient teaching regarding administration. Maintains investigational drug accountability. -In collaboration with the physician, reviews patients for changes in condition, adverse events, concomitant medication use, protocol compliance, response to study drug and thoroughly documents all findings. Responsible for accurate and timely data collection, documentation, entry, and reporting. Schedules and participates in monitoring and auditing activities. Maintains regulatory documents in accordance with USOR SOP and applicable regulations. Participates in required training and education programs. Responsible for education of clinic staff regarding clinical research. May collaborate with Research Site Leader in the study selection process. Additional responsibilities may include working directly with other (non-USOR) research bases and/or sponsors. Identify quality and performance improvement opportunities and collaborates with staff in the development of action plans to improve quality. May be responsible for compiling and reporting protocol activity, accrual data, and research financial information to practice administration and physicians. May oversee the preparation of orders by physicians to assure that protocol compliance is maintained. Communicates with physician regarding study requirements, need for dose modification, and adverse event reporting. Provides a safe environment for patients, families, and clinical staff at all times through compliance with all federal, state, and professional regulatory standards as issued through OSHA and the CDC. Maintains strict patient confidentiality according to HIPAA regulations and applicable law. Qualifications Associate's degree in a clinical or scientific related discipline required, Bachelor's degree preferred. Minimum five years of experience in a clinical or scientific related discipline required, preferably in oncology. SoCRA or ACRP certification preferred. OR Graduate from an accredited program for nursing education (BSN preferred). Minimum 3 years of nursing experience, preferably in oncology. Experience in clinical research preferred. Current licensure as a registered nurse in state of practice. Current BLCS or ACLS certification required. OCN, SoCRA or ACRP certification preferred. How much does a clinical coordinator earn in Cherry Creek, CO?

The average clinical coordinator in Cherry Creek, CO earns between $36,000 and $71,000 annually. This compares to the national average clinical coordinator range of $43,000 to $77,000.

Average clinical coordinator salary in Cherry Creek, CO

$51,000
